请求的手动发送
class SecondPipeline(object):
f = None
def open_spider(self,spider):
print('start')
self.f = open('./qiubai.text','w',encoding='utf-8')
def process_item(self, item, spider):
self.f.write(item['author']+':'+ item['content'])
return item
def close_spider(self,spider):
self.f.close()
print('end')
import scrapy
from second.items import SecondItem
class QiubaiSpider(scrapy.Spider):
name = 'qiubai'
# allowed_domains = ['www.qiushibaike.com']
start_urls = ['https://www.qiushibaike.com/text/']
url = 'https://www.qiushibaike.com/text/page/%d/'
pageNum = 1
def parse(self, response):
print('正在爬虫')
div_list = response.xpath("//div[@id='content-left']/div")
for div in div_list:
author = div.xpath('./div/a[2]/h2/text()').extract_first()
content = div.xpath(".//div[@class='content']/span/text()").extract_first()
items = SecondItem()
items['author'] = author
items['content'] = content
yield items
# 执行到此,第一个url已经获取成功,
# 手动添加url,yield scrapy.Request,
# callback 函数解析,可以自定义,也可以再次利用parse,不加(),递归加条件
# url = 'https://www.qiushibaike.com/text/page/2/'
# yield scrapy.Request(url=url, callback=self.parse)
if self.pageNum <= 13:
self.pageNum += 1
new_url = format(self.url % self.pageNum)
yield scrapy.Request(url=new_url, callback=self.parse)
小结:
- 多个url手动添加,callback函数执行
- 页面布局一致时,循环调用解析函数递归注意终止条件
- yield scrapy.Request
- 注意面向对象 数据属性 与实例化对象 结合的特性!
- format函数的使用
